Valeda® Photobiomodulation for Dry Macular Degeneration

A New Treatment Option for Dry Age-Related Macular Degeneration

For many years, patients with dry age-related macular degeneration (AMD) had limited treatment options beyond nutritional supplements, lifestyle changes, and careful monitoring.

The Valeda® Light Delivery System introduces a different approach. Valeda uses photobiomodulation (PBM)—specific wavelengths of light delivered to the eye—to treat appropriate patients with dry AMD. It is the first photobiomodulation device to receive FDA De Novo authorization for improving visual acuity in certain patients with dry AMD.

What Is Valeda?

Valeda is a noninvasive, light-based treatment for certain patients with dry age-related macular degeneration.

The treatment uses three specific wavelengths of light—590 nm, 660 nm, and 850 nm—delivered in a carefully controlled sequence. This process is known as photobiomodulation, or PBM.

Unlike an injection or surgical procedure, Valeda treatment does not involve needles or incisions.

Each individual treatment takes only a few minutes. A treatment series consists of nine sessions, typically performed three times per week over three to five weeks.


Who May Be a Candidate for Valeda?

Valeda is not intended for every patient with macular degeneration. A comprehensive examination and retinal imaging are necessary to determine whether treatment is appropriate.

The FDA-authorized indication includes patients with:

  • Dry age-related macular degeneration
  • Best-corrected vision between 20/32 and 20/70
  • At least three medium drusen (>63 to ≤125 μm), large drusen (>125 μm), or non-central geographic atrophy
  • No neovascular (“wet”) AMD
  • No center-involving geographic atrophy

What Does the Treatment Feel Like?

Valeda is performed in the office and does not require an injection or surgery.

During treatment, you sit comfortably at the device with your chin and forehead positioned similarly to many of the instruments used during a routine eye examination. The device delivers controlled red, amber, and near-infrared light while you alternate between having your eyes open and closed.

The light-delivery portion for each treated eye lasts approximately 250 seconds—just over four minutes.

A complete initial treatment series consists of nine visits.

What Does the Research Show?

Valeda has been studied in the LIGHTSITE clinical trials, including the randomized, double-masked, sham-controlled LIGHTSITE III trial.

At 24 months, LIGHTSITE III reported improvement in visual acuity among Valeda-treated eyes. At month 21, the treated group averaged a 6.2-letter improvement from baseline, and 61.5% of treated eyes had gained at least five letters. The study also reported a lower incidence of new geographic atrophy in treated eyes than in sham-treated eyes at 24 months (6.8% versus 24.0%).

Importantly, those findings should not be interpreted to mean that every patient will gain vision or that Valeda prevents AMD from progressing.

The FDA-authorized labeling states that after approximately two years, treatment produced an improvement in mean visual acuity of approximately one ETDRS line compared with patients who did not receive treatment in the clinical study.

Individual results vary.


Valeda Does Not Replace Routine AMD Care

Valeda is an additional treatment option—not a replacement for monitoring macular degeneration.

Depending upon your individual condition, AMD care may continue to include:

Regular dilated eye examinations and OCT imaging
AREDS2 supplementation when appropriate
Smoking cessation and healthy lifestyle choices
Home monitoring for changes in central vision
Prompt evaluation for symptoms of wet AMD

Patients can still develop wet AMD or progression of dry AMD and therefore require continued monitoring.

Frequently Asked Questions

Is Valeda FDA approved?

The Valeda Light Delivery System received FDA De Novo authorization in November 2024 as a Class II prescription device for improving visual acuity in a defined population of patients with dry age-related macular degeneration.

Is Valeda a laser?

No. Valeda uses LEDs to deliver non-coherent light at specific wavelengths. The treatment is known as photobiomodulation (PBM).

Does Valeda involve injections?

No. Valeda is noninvasive and does not require an injection, incision, or surgery.

How many treatments will I need?

One treatment series consists of nine treatments performed three times per week over approximately three to five weeks. The pivotal LIGHTSITE III clinical trial repeated treatment series approximately every four months during the 24-month study. Your ophthalmologist will determine an appropriate treatment and monitoring plan.

Will Valeda restore my vision?

Valeda should not be presented as restoring normal vision or curing AMD. Clinical trials demonstrated an improvement in average visual acuity in appropriately selected patients, but individual responses vary. The FDA labeling describes an average benefit of approximately one ETDRS line after about two years compared with untreated controls.

Can Valeda treat wet macular degeneration?

No. The FDA-authorized patient population excludes neovascular, or wet, AMD. Wet AMD requires a different treatment approach and should be evaluated promptly.

Can Valeda treat geographic atrophy?

The authorized indication can include non-central geographic atrophy, but excludes center-involving geographic atrophy. An examination and retinal imaging are necessary to determine whether an individual patient meets the treatment criteria.

Is Valeda right for everyone with dry AMD?

No. Patient selection is important. In addition to the AMD and visual-acuity criteria, there are contraindications and precautions. For example, the FDA labeling advises against treatment in patients with certain light sensitivities or light-activated neurologic disorders and discusses precautions related to photosensitizing medications and populations not adequately studied in the pivotal trial.

Important Safety Information

Valeda is a prescription medical device intended for a defined population of patients with dry age-related macular degeneration. It is not appropriate for every patient with AMD. Patients with known photosensitivity to yellow, red, or near-infrared light or a history of certain light-activated central nervous system disorders should not be treated. Certain photosensitizing medications may also affect eligibility. Safety and effectiveness have not been established in several populations excluded from the pivotal clinical trial. Please discuss your complete medical and ocular history and medications with your ophthalmologist.
